Learn About Local Number Portability at TMC's ITEXPO West 2009 Conference Session

September 02, 2009

By Jessica Kostek
TMCnet Channel Editor

CEO Jim Dalton (News - Alert) of Atlanta-based TransNexus – a company that provides software for least-cost routing, traffic reporting, profitability analysis and billing for VoIP networks –will be speaking Thursday September 3, 2009 at TMC’s ITEXPO (News - Alert) giving an introduction to local number portability.

 
The conference session, titled, “Intro to Local Number Portability: What VoIP Providers Need to Know,” will be held at the Los Angeles Convention Center.
 
According to Dalton, misrouted calls still get completed, so end-users do not realize that there’s a service issue.
 
“But the service provider gets stuck with a termination charge larger than necessary because the call was not routed to the lowest cost provider,” Dalton told TMC President Rich Tehrani (News - Alert) in an interview. “TransNexus (News - Alert) will be releasing a new version of its free OSPrey routing server which will include the ability to host locally, or query, the U.S. number portability database managed by NeuStar (News - Alert).”
 
The ITEXPO West 2009 presentation will be a tutorial on local number portability. It will explain in detail how LNP works and why it can save VoIP operators money and improve their service. The presentation will focus on providing practical details on how VoIP operators can implement LNP using freely available software.
